Product Description:
This compound is primarily utilized in advanced organic synthesis and materials science due to its unique structural and electronic properties. It serves as a key intermediate in the development of specialized phosphorous-containing ligands, which are crucial in catalysis, particularly for asymmetric transformations. Its trifluoro and sulfonamide groups enhance its stability and reactivity, making it suitable for creating complex molecular architectures. Additionally, it finds application in the design of optoelectronic materials, where its extended aromatic systems contribute to desirable electronic properties for use in organic light-emitting diodes (OLEDs) or photovoltaic devices.
